## Changelog — Ticktrace 1.9

### Renamed: DRIFT_API_TOKEN
During the cron drift investigation we found plugins confusing this variable with the metrics token, so it has been renamed to indicate it authorizes drift-report uploads specifically. Plugin authors must read the new name from 1.9 onward; the old name is ignored without warning. Sample env files in the SDK are updated. In your deployment env file, the drift-report upload secret is set on the next line.

env line for fawef-taguf: VAULT_KEY13=a9695905a9a90

## Configuration: blue-green deploys

New to the Tollgate billing worker? Quick primer: we run two identical stacks, blue and green, and flip traffic between them during releases. The flip is controlled by `DEPLOY_COLOR` in `worker.env` — never edit it by hand, the switcher script owns it. You do need to set `DRAIN_TIMEOUT_SEC=90` so in-flight invoices finish before cutover. The switcher also authenticates to the routing layer with a credential, which sits on the line right after the timeout.

env line for bagap-yajep: COURIER_KEY20=b4db4e5e33a646898766

## Further Reading

Plugins built for the Quillbrook editor must vendor their own font files rather than relying on host-bundled typefaces. This keeps rendering deterministic across tenant deployments. See the licensing checklist before bundling any third-party font, and run the subset validator as part of your build. The full vendoring guide for plugin authors is published here.

wiki page, tahaf-tajog: https://jira.ordindyn.corp/pipeline

Welcome to on-call for Bouncewell, our email bounce processor. Most weeks it's quiet — the queue drains itself and the dashboards stay green. If bounces pile up, first check the Fernbrook SMTP relay status page, then restart the classifier worker if it's stuck on a malformed DSN. You'll need access to the internal suppression-list service to requeue or purge addresses; that's where 90% of incidents get fixed. Requests to it are authenticated per-engineer, but on-call uses the shared service credential below.

API key for yagef-bagef: zpat23_RTEspBOEmE9eDRK8oFjwnRE